Our family’s understanding of living with high functioning Autism (aka ‘Aspergers Syndrome’) is relatively new, with the official diagnosis made less than 18 months ago. But our experience living with Autism characteristics goes back much further.

 

Aspergers is less common in girls, and often the symptoms are milder (or less obvious), which often leads to much later diagnoses.  This can make life tough for both the ‘Aspie’ and their family, because until there is a diagnosis – there is misunderstanding.  Misunderstanding leads to an ongoing battle of trying to fit a square peg in a round hole and not understanding why - no matter how much of your time, energy, love and effort you spend - it just won’t fit.

 

The official diagnosis gave us the confirmation we needed to start approaching our day to day life from a new perspective – it can still be tough, but at least we know why, and over time we are all learning different ways to approach, communicate, respond, react to our day to day challenges together.

 

Autism is being talked about more and with more awareness, comes more understanding, support and acceptance.  That is why I want to do what I can to help raise funds for charities such as 4ASD Kids.  These kids (and the teens and adults they are to become) along with their families need more support to enable them to feel more secure and accepted for their quirks and to feel they have a place in this confusing, overwhelming world, as much as anyone else.

 

Parenting an aspie can be overwhelming and often my parenting methods are misunderstood – this is hardest when it is from friends and family members.  But my challenges are nothing compared to my daughter’s as she is trying to make sense of life while also dealing with being misunderstood by people around her in the process.  This is one of the cruellest aspects of Autism - feeling different, excluded and judged for being yourself even though you have so much to offer.

4 ASD Kids Charitable Trust

In 2009 we went public about our son Max’s battle with autism. It’s something that we considered very deeply but felt by telling our story we may be able to assist families with similar challenges. After the initial publicity we were so overwhelmed by the messages of support and assistance that we formed our charity, 4 ASD Kids. Our dream is to be able to change the lives of families with children battling with an Autism Spectrum Disorder by assisting them to access the early intervention treatment that we believe is critical to giving these kids the best chance at leading a normal life and reaching their full potential.
